The Werk Art Gallery and Object Lab announced the Have Yourself a Merry Little Krampusnacht holiday art show and Christmas market, taking place this Friday, December 5, from 5-9 pm in their beautiful Arts District gallery and shop.
The free event checks every box when it comes to what we love about St. Pete, featuring incredible art, live performances, local vendors and artists, great food, and sustainable shopping with antiques and vintage items. Fire performers will be the star of the show, alongside art and gifts from local artists and makers, tasty Krampus food from Currywurst German food truck, and even freshly-mulled hot cider. Even new local coffeeshop, Ruya, will be there serving mulled wine called Glühwein in Germany!
The Werk Gallery is located at 2210 1st Avenue South, and it has become one of our favorite arts hubs in the city. Friday’s event is the excuse you need if you haven’t yet visited this local star.

The Werk Art Gallery & Object Lab is a hotspot for all things beautiful
Since opening in 2023, The Werk has become a star in St. Pete. As you enter, The Werk Art Gallery is home to a curated list of rotating exhibits featuring an amazing array of local artists. As you walk through the gallery, the space opens up into The Object Lab, a one-of-a-kind art and gift store offering a deep selection of beautiful pieces, from greeting cards, oil paintings and jewelry, to antique pottery, altered vintage clothing and even a sticker bar.
Between it all, The Werk has become a hotspot in St. Pete for all things art and antiques. The gallery has played host to a tremendous lineup of exhibitions, and has plenty in store for 2026.
While the gallery space is what draws many people in for the first time, it’s The Object Lab that can make you lose hours to browsing. Whether admiring artwork, sniffing candles, or trying on hand-painted tees, the shop is packed full of delights for any taste or inclination.


You can find vintage scarves and signed ephemera on the same wall as luxury handbags and altered vintage jackets created by Spenny Lane. You’ll find pottery dating back 800 years to the Ming Dynasty on a shelf next to pottery only a few weeks old created by a local artist.
In the same place, you can get a quirky $4 sticker or a funny gift card, or spring for high end art pieces or jewelry. The job they have done stocking The Object Lab is outstanding, making it feel like you’re walking around a colorful combination of a museum, gift shop, and arts and crafts store.
